Eleven season defining days
Four defeats in 11 days have ended our season in my view. Too many injuries to defenders & too many games in too short a period have taken their toll
For those of us who disagree, consider the following:
Birmingham, Wycombe, Wrexham & arguably Stockport are too far ahead of us. That only leaves 2 play off positions up for grabs.
Charlton are 6 poins clear of us with a game in hand & currently in very good form.
Bolton are a number of points ahead with a game in hand & in similarly good form.
Huddersfield are 5 points clear from the same number of games.
The one bright spot is our goal difference.
There is only 1 scenario which will make me revise my opinion & it is this:
We win the next 4 - Northampton, Blackpool, Mansfield & Stevenage. Do this & we might just be back in contention but it's a tough ask.
So sadly, our play off ambitions are almost certainly not achievable I hope I'm wrong & if I am wrong then I'd be delighted to be reminded.
